Furnaces Alloy Studded Tubes ASTM A335 P5 Ideal For Corrosive Environment

 

ASTM A335/ASME SA335 specification for seamless ferritic alloy steel pipe for high temperature service, for example: pipeline systems of power stations, petrochemical plants and oil refineries,etc.This standard encompasses multiple grades, each corresponding to a specific alloy chemical composition and performance. Grade is usually indicated by the letter "P" followed by a number, which roughly represents one percent of the chromium content in the alloy.

 

It must be manufactured by seamless processes, such as hot rolling, cold drawing or extrusion.

Related Tests: Chemical Analysis, Tension Test ( Tensile Strength, Yield Strength, Elongation), Hydrostatic Test, Nondestructive Examination (Eddy Current Testing-ET, Ultrasonic Testing-UT), Hardness Test, Metastographic Examination and other Supplementary Requirements.

 

Chemical Composition (%)

 

Grade C Mn P S Si Cr Mo
P5 0.15max 0.30-0.60 0.025 0.025 0.50max 4.00-6.00 0.45-0.65

 

Mechanical Properties

 

Grade Tensile Strength,min Yield Strength (0.2%Offset,min)
P5 60ksi (415 MPa) 30ksi (205 MPa)

 

Studded Tubes

 

In petrochemical industry, studded tubes are widely used. Especially in tubular furnaces, in order to enhance the heat transfer effect outside the tube, the heat transfer element often adopts studded tubes. 

 

Studded tubes typically produced from materials such as carbon steel, stainless steel, alloy or copper, providing durability and resistance to corrosion.

 

Application 

 

Cooling systems

Common in cooling towers, condensers, and evaporators.

 

Heat Exchangers,Furnaces

Furnace waterwall panels of chemical recovery boilers;Metallurgical Furnaces; Petrochemical Heaters; Waste Incinerators.

Widely used in industrial heat exchangers for power generation, petrochemical processes, and HVAC systems.

 

Marine Applications

Used in ship cooling systems and other marine heat exchangers where robust performance is required.
